cadC
  • BacMet ID: BAC0056
  • Code for: Regulator
  • Family: Contains 1 HTH arsR-type DNA-binding domain
  • Sequence: FASTA
  • Cross-database IDs: Link
  • Organism: Staphylococcus aureus
  • Location: Plasmid pI258 (Staphylococcus aureus)
  • Compound: Cadmium (Cd), Bismuth (Bi), Zinc (Zn), Lead (Pb)
  • Description: Found in cad operon; bind to cad operator/promoter, its a repressor protein in the operon; Metal-binding repressor for the cad operon. Involved in resistance to heavy metals, such as cadmium, bismuth, zinc or lead. Binds 2 metal ions per subunit. Metal binding to the N-terminal regulatory site causes the repressor to dissociate from the DNA
  • Length (amino acid): 122
  • Reference: Endo et al. 1995; Pubmed- 7543476
